=pod

=head1 NAME

test_dbd_driver.pl - Perform tests on a DBD driver to see if it may work with SPOPS

=head1 SYNOPSIS

 # Create a table to test -- test_dbd_driver.sql has a sample. (This
 # is database-specific.)

 # Mysql

 mysql --user=root --password=password test < test_dbd_driver.sql

 # Sybase/MS SQL

 isql -Usa -Dmaster -Ppassword -i test_dbd_driver.sql

 # Postgres

 psql -U postgres test < test_dbd_driver.sql

 # Edit the file 'test_dbd_driver.dat' with connection info

 dbd         mysql
 dsn         test
 usename     nobody
 password    nobody
 table       spopstest

 # Run the test

 perl test_dbd_driver.pl
